ANDREW JAMES MILLER v ASSOCIATED NEWSPAPERS LTD (2011)

PUBLISHED November 11, 2011
SHARE

Words published by a newspaper were defamatory of the claimant. They meant that there were reasonable grounds to suspect that, because of his friendship with the Metropolitan Police Commissioner, he was a willing beneficiary of improper conduct and cronyism in respect to the award to his company of a series of police service contracts worth millions of pounds of public money that had not been put out to tender.

QBD (Tugendhat J) 11/11/2011
[2011] EWHC 2677 (QB)
